What is Full Bloom?

Full Bloom is a term commonly associated with the floral industry, where it refers to flowers that are at the peak of their blossoming stage, displaying their maximum beauty and fragrance. In another context, 'Full Bloom' is also the title of a popular television competition series focused on floral design, where florists compete in creative challenges. The show highlights the artistry and skill involved in floral arrangements and provides inspiration for both professionals and hobbyists in the field.

Job description

Job Title: Hospice Associate Medical Director (MD/DO)
Location: Firestone, Colorado Area
About Bloom:
Bloom Healthcare is an innovative, employee-owned primary care and hospice practice delivering high-touch, home-based care to vulnerable patients. Recognized as a "Top Workplace" for seven years, we prioritize team well-being to deliver exceptional patient care.
Job Summary
The Associate Medical Director (AMD) provides clinical leadership and medical oversight for Bloom's Hospice Program, blending patient care, regulatory compliance, and interdisciplinary guidance to ensure compassionate, high-quality end-of-life care aligned with patient goals and Bloom's integrated model.
Key Responsibilities
Clinical Care & Medical Oversight
  • Serve as attending/supervising physician for hospice patients, managing symptom control, hospice evaluations, and care direction (primarily remote/telehealth).
  • Assist in the face-to-face encounter process (third benefit period+) on a limited, as-needed basis only.
  • Review, certify, and recertify terminal illness with compliant, clinically sound documentation.
  • Offer consultation on complex symptom management and goals-of-care discussions.

Interdisciplinary Collaboration & Leadership
  • Lead yourbi-weekly interdisciplinary team meetings, providing medical expertise for care planning and team decisions.
  • Work closely with Bloom primary care attending MDs and community providers to support seamless transitions, shared accountability, and continuity between primary care and hospice.
  • Collaborate with nursing, social work, spiritual care, and other team members; provide clinical guidance and education to enhance hospice/palliative best practices.

Quality, Compliance, and Clinical Excellence
  • Ensure alignment with CMS regulations, state rules, and Bloom policies through documentation, audits, and quality initiatives.
  • Contribute to symptom control, patient/family experience, and workflow improvements.

Qualifications
  • MD or DO with active Colorado license and DEA.
  • Board certification in Internal Medicine, Family Medicine, Geriatrics, Hospice & Palliative Medicine, or related field preferred.
  • Hospice, palliative, or serious illness experience strongly preferred.
  • Strong clinical judgment, communication, and interdisciplinary collaboration skills.

Work Environment & Expectations
  • Limited travel required - occasional visits to patient homes or facilities for required face-to-face encounters and select IDG meetings; most clinical work and meetings are remote/virtual.
  • Participate in shared remote call rotation (approx. every 6 weeks; team-based to promote sustainability).

Why Bloom?
Competitive salary ($220K-$250K base in CO, plus bonuses/stock options), full benefits (100% employer-covered health plans option), 401(k), generous PTO, professional growth, and a collaborative, purpose-driven culture.
